Advertisement

GitHub Labels: 使用JSON文件和Python设置或获取标签

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
本文介绍了如何使用JSON文件与Python脚本自动化管理GitHub仓库中的标签,涵盖创建、更新及维护流程。 这是一个简单的Python文件,用于管理GitHub存储库的标签。该脚本可以将标签从存储库保存到JSON文件,并可以从JSON文件加载到存储库中。 如果需要将公共存储库(例如https://github.com/octocat/Hello-World)的标签保存至名为hello-world-labels.json的文件,则可以通过调用命令`python github_labels.py -f hello-world-labels.json -u octocat -r Hello-World`来实现。对于私有存储库,可以添加身份验证参数 `-t 381someSampleTokenHere3241` 或 `-p octaCatPassword`。 在JSON文件创建后,可以通过调用命令 `python github_labels.py -f github-labels.json -u Ma` 将标签设置回存储库。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• GitHub Labels: 使JSONPython
    优质
    本文介绍了如何使用JSON文件与Python脚本自动化管理GitHub仓库中的标签,涵盖创建、更新及维护流程。 这是一个简单的Python文件,用于管理GitHub存储库的标签。该脚本可以将标签从存储库保存到JSON文件,并可以从JSON文件加载到存储库中。 如果需要将公共存储库(例如https://github.com/octocat/Hello-World)的标签保存至名为hello-world-labels.json的文件,则可以通过调用命令`python github_labels.py -f hello-world-labels.json -u octocat -r Hello-World`来实现。对于私有存储库,可以添加身份验证参数 `-t 381someSampleTokenHere3241` 或 `-p octaCatPassword`。 在JSON文件创建后,可以通过调用命令 `python github_labels.py -f github-labels.json -u Ma` 将标签设置回存储库。
  • labels数据.json
    优质
    labels数据文件.json包含各类标签的信息和分类,用于机器学习项目中的训练模型和数据标注任务,便于对图像、文本等进行自动化识别与管理。 请提供需要我帮助重写的文字内容,以便我能更好地进行处理。如果没有提到具体的联系信息或网址,则直接按照要求调整表述即可。
  • Python 使递归夹中的名及分类
    优质
    本项目通过Python编程实现递归算法来遍历指定目录下的所有子文件夹及其包含的文件,并为每个文件自动添加分类标签。此方法简化了大规模数据集管理,提升了工作效率。 在深度学习领域,数据预处理是一个至关重要的步骤,尤其是在数据分布在多个子文件夹中的情况下。在这个场景下,我们需要从一个包含多级子文件夹的结构中递归地收集文件名,并同时获取每个文件对应的类别标签。这通常用于构建训练集和测试集,以便进行模型的训练和评估。 我们首先导入了两个必要的库:`os` 和 `re`。其中,`os` 库提供了与操作系统交互的功能,包括读取目录、检查文件类型等;而 `re` 库则用于正则表达式操作,在这里主要用于从文件路径中提取类别标签。 代码定义了一个名为 `getallfile` 的函数,其作用是递归遍历指定路径下的所有子目录和文件。该函数接收一个参数 `path`,即要开始遍历的目录路径。通过调用 `os.listdir(path)` 来获取此路径下所有的文件和子目录名,并使用循环逐个处理它们。 对于每个文件或子目录,在构造完整的文件或子目录路径后,如果它是一个子目录,则函数会递归地继续遍历该子目录;若为一个文件,则其完整路径将被添加到 `allpath` 列表中,而文件名则会被加入到 `allname` 列表里。 接下来定义了一个名为 `Test` 的函数,负责处理获取的文件信息并将其写入指定的输出文件。该函数首先调用 `getallfile(path)` 来收集所有需要的信息,然后使用正则表达式从路径中提取类别标签,并将这些信息保存到文本段落件里。 这段代码实现了一个功能:递归遍历包含多级子目录的文件结构,收集所有文件的完整路径和对应的类别标签,并将其写入到一个输出文本段落件。这种数据预处理方法在深度学习项目的数据准备阶段非常有用,尤其是在处理大量分类图像时更为常见。需要注意的是,在实际应用中可能需要根据具体情况调整正则表达式以确保正确提取类别标签。
  • Python Pandas读CSV的方法
    优质
    本文介绍了如何使用Python的Pandas库读取CSV文件,并提供了获取数据帧中所有列标签的具体方法和示例代码。 今天为大家分享如何使用Python的pandas库读取CSV文件后获取列标签的方法。这具有很好的参考价值,希望能对大家有所帮助。一起跟随文章继续了解吧。
  • 使Python的BeautifulSoup爬虫库、属性内容等信息
    优质
    本教程介绍如何利用Python的BeautifulSoup库进行网页数据抓取,包括解析HTML文档、提取特定标签及其属性与文本内容的方法。 如何使用Python的BeautifulSoup库来获取对象(标签)名、属性、内容及注释等内容呢?下面为大家介绍一些基本操作。 一、Tag(标签)对象 1. Tag对象与XML或HTML文档中的tag相同。 ```python from bs4 import BeautifulSoup soup = BeautifulSoup(Extremely bold, lxml) tag = soup.b type(tag) # 输出结果为:bs4.element.Tag 2. Tag的Name属性 每个Tag都有自己的名字,可以通过.name来获取。 ```python tag = soup.b print(tag.name) # 输出:b # 可以修改tag的名字: tag.name = blockquote ``` 注意,在对原始文档进行操作时,可能会导致输出结果发生变化。
  • JavaScript (适于 Input TextArea)
    优质
    本篇文章讲解如何使用JavaScript获取和设置输入框(Input和Textarea)中的光标位置,并提供示例代码帮助开发者实现相关功能。 JavaScript可以用来获取和设置输入框(包括文本框和多行文本区域)中的光标位置。实现这一功能需要考虑不同浏览器之间的兼容性问题。通过编写相应的函数,可以在各种环境下准确地操作光标的当前位置。这种技术在开发复杂的表单交互应用时非常有用。
  • Python 使 os.walk() 目录的实例
    优质
    本教程详细介绍如何使用 Python 的 `os` 模块中的 `walk()` 函数来遍历指定路径下的所有文件和子目录,并提供了几个实用示例。 在Python 3.6版本中移除了`os.path.walk()`函数,并引入了`os.walk()`函数。该函数的声明如下:walk(top, topdown=True, onerror=None)。 1、参数top表示需要遍历的目录树路径。 2、参数topdown默认为True,意味着首先返回根目录下的文件,然后依次递归地访问子目录中的文件。如果将此值设置为False,则会先遍历所有子目录,并在最后返回根目录下的文件。 3、onerror的默认值是“None”,表示忽略遍历时遇到的所有错误;若不为空,则提供一个自定义函数来处理这些错误。 该函数执行后将返回一个元组,包含三个元素。
  • Java使Swing
    优质
    本教程介绍如何在Java Swing图形用户界面中捕获和显示鼠标的当前位置坐标。通过事件监听器跟踪鼠标移动,并更新界面上的坐标信息。适合初学者了解Swing组件与事件处理机制。 直接运行代码就可以弹出一个Swing页面,并根据鼠标的移动位置在界面上显示鼠标坐标。此功能已经亲测有效,欢迎下载使用。